Daikanyama's “Bibibi.” opens at 6 p.m., with 11 breweries on Today’s TAP
On May 11, 2026, the beer pub “Bibibi.” in Daikanyama opened at 6 p.m. On Instagram, it listed 11 breweries under “Today’s TAP,” guiding drinkers to a beer for the season as temperatures rise.
The craft-beer-focused beer pub “Bibibi.” in Daikanyama updated its tap list on Instagram.
In the post, it touched on the changing season, saying, “The lingering afterglow of Golden Week has faded, but temperatures will keep rising from here, and beer’s delicious season is on the way,” and noting, “OPEN from 6 p.m. today as well.” The shop is a small standing bar in Daikanyama-cho, Shibuya Ward, Tokyo, and is known for its concept: “The more you know about the brewer and their background, the more delicious the drink becomes.”

Within the 8-tsubo interior, just a short walk from Daikanyama Station, “Bibibi.” offers the charm of slowly savoring a beer with the brewer’s face and story behind it. It was a post that made you want to keep following the tap lineup as the seasons change.
